Summary

OR13C7 (olfactory receptor family 13 subfamily C member 7 (gene/pseudogene), HGNC:15102) is a protein-coding gene on chromosome 9p13.3, encoding Olfactory receptor 13C7 (P0DN81). Odorant receptor.

Olfactory receptors interact with odorant molecules in the nose, to initiate a neuronal response that triggers the perception of a smell. The olfactory receptor proteins are members of a large family of G-protein-coupled receptors (GPCR) arising from single coding-exon genes. Olfactory receptors share a 7-transmembrane domain structure with many neurotransmitter and hormone receptors and are responsible for the recognition and G protein-mediated transduction of odorant signals. The olfactory receptor gene family is the largest in the genome. This olfactory receptor gene is a segregating pseudogene, where some individuals have an allele that encodes a functional olfactory receptor, while other individuals have an allele encoding a protein that is predicted to be non-functional.

Function. Odorant receptor.

Subcellular location. Cell membrane.

Polymorphism. Segregating pseudogene, locus showing both intact and pseudogene forms in the population. A double nucleotide deletion at position Pro-144 in the gene coding for this protein is responsible for functional diversity, producing a pseudogene.

Similarity. Belongs to the G-protein coupled receptor 1 family.
